# # ChangeLog for uspace/lib/urcu in mainline # # Generated by Trac 1.6 # 2025-08-30T22:15:42Z Thu, 09 Oct 2014 15:11:26 GMT Jakub Jermar [fd1b1ce] * uspace/lib/urcu/rcu.h (modified) Fix include for bool. Tue, 04 Dec 2012 16:46:43 GMT Adam Hraska [b188002] * uspace/lib/urcu/rcu.c (modified) urcu: Assert that we are in a reader section when unlocking via ... Tue, 04 Dec 2012 16:42:06 GMT Adam Hraska [156b6406] * uspace/app/rcubench/rcubench.c (modified) * uspace/lib/c/generic/futex.c (modified) * uspace/lib/c/generic/malloc.c (modified) * uspace/lib/c/include/futex.h (modified) * uspace/lib/urcu/rcu.c (modified) Differentiated futexes when used with mutex semantics from those with ... Tue, 04 Dec 2012 15:54:40 GMT Adam Hraska [32d2e60] * uspace/app/rcubench/rcubench.c (modified) * uspace/lib/c/generic/futex.c (modified) * uspace/lib/c/include/futex.h (modified) * uspace/lib/urcu/rcu.c (modified) Compilation fixes of upgradable futexes. Tue, 04 Dec 2012 03:48:21 GMT Adam Hraska [1b7eec9] * uspace/lib/c/include/futex.h (modified) * uspace/lib/c/include/sys/time.h (modified) * uspace/lib/urcu/rcu.c (modified) * uspace/lib/urcu/rcu.h (modified) urcu: rcu_synchronize allows to specify if it may block the current ... Fri, 23 Nov 2012 19:57:38 GMT Adam Hraska [a2f42e5] * uspace/lib/urcu/rcu.c (modified) * uspace/lib/urcu/rcu.h (modified) urcu: Fixed rcu_synchronize() early exit condition. Fri, 23 Nov 2012 01:23:17 GMT Adam Hraska [99022de] * uspace/lib/urcu/rcu.c (modified) urcu: Added early exit for rcu_synchronize() if it was stuck waiting ... Thu, 22 Nov 2012 21:26:08 GMT Adam Hraska [a82d33d] * uspace/Makefile (modified) * uspace/Makefile.common (modified) * uspace/lib/urcu/Makefile (added) * uspace/lib/urcu/rcu.c (added) * uspace/lib/urcu/rcu.h (added) urcu: Initial implementation.